Pronoun [Danish]

IPA: /voː/, [ˈvoːˀ]
Etymology: From Old Danish hwa, hwo. Old nominative masculine of hvem (“who”), hvad (“what”) and hvis (“if”) Etymology templates: {{inh|da|gmq-oda|hwa}} Old Danish hwa Head templates: {{head|da|pronoun}} hvo
  1. (obsolete) who Tags: obsolete Synonyms: hvem Derived forms: hvo intet vover, intet vinder

Pronoun [Norwegian Bokmål]

Head templates: {{head|nb|pronoun}} hvo
  1. (archaic or poetic) who Tags: archaic, poetic Synonyms: hvem

Pronoun [Scanian]

IPA: [ʊ́], [hʊ́] Forms: case and gender hvim [oblique]
Etymology: From Old Norse hvar, from Proto-Germanic *hwaz. Etymology templates: {{inh|gmq-scy|non|hvar}} Old Norse hvar, {{inh|gmq-scy|gem-pro|*hwaz}} Proto-Germanic *hwaz Head templates: {{head|gmq-scy|pronoun|oblique case and gender|hvim|g=m}} hvo m (oblique case and gender hvim)
  1. who Tags: masculine
